Scope and content
Keyboards and Music Player.
Vol. 1, No. 1 - September 1981
Contents:
- Keyboard news. A unique wedding gift for the young royals
- The keyboard interview. Jerry Allen's unusual path to stardom
- As I see it. Alan Ashton's popular chat column
- Latest models. The new Symphonie and Johannus organs
- Three of a kind. John Mann contributes a breezy feature
- Home organ test I. The brand-new Gem wizard 315 analysed
- Win a wizard! Enter our competition - and win an organ
- Home organ test II. Another Gem - the top-of-the-range H-7000
- It's easier than you think. Organ wizard Jerry Allen tells why
- Why I play the organ. Because it's fun says Carole Kyte
- Organ adventure. Learn to play the organ the easy way
- Easy-play music. 'Jesu, joy of man desiring' made simple
- Play the William Davies way. Tips on varies accompaniments
- In the keyboards style. Neil Diamond's 'Sweet Caroline'
- Teen scene. Ian Griffin - an up-and-coming star
- Portable test. The Casiotone 202 - a preset polyphonic
- Rock report. With a German accent from Tangerine Dream
- Sounds Synthesized. Dave Crombie explains all for the layman
- Synthesizer test. An exciting new monophonic - the Pro-One
- How it works. Electronics made easy by Ron Coates
- Which organ. Where 'you' are the judges of today's organs
- Theatre organs. Frank Hare looks at the Stanford Hall Wurlitzer
- Greats of the golden age. An affectionate portrait of James Bell
- From the organ loft. What 'the' wedding meant for organists
- Classical organ. The epoch-making Frobenius in Queen's College
- Organ masters. Peter Hurford on organs and organ techniques
- Classical organ test. The best-selling Johannus Opus 6N
- Club roundup. All the latest from the organ clubs
- At the piano. David Hellewell on digital dexterity
- Piano test report. A right Royale model from Holland
- Book reviews. So you want to play by ear? Read this!
- Record reviews. New discs from Jerry Allen and others
- Music reviews. It's easy to play pops
- Meet the keyboard team. Profiles on all our contributors
- Put a squeeze on. Jimmy Clinkscale writes for accordionists
- New organ price list. Retail prices of the current models
